According to 2022 data, the most numerous races in Bayport, MN are White alone (2,862 residents), Black alone (704 residents), and Hispanic (155 residents). 90.6% of Bayport residents speak English at home. 4.3% of Bayport, MN residents are foreign-born (1.4% born in Latin America, 1.4% born in Asia, 1.2% born in Africa), which is 84.2% less than the foreign-born rate of 8.0% across the entire state of Minnesota.
